You must have enjoyed the oily, spicy paneer butter masala in a restaurant, but tell me honestly - can you eat it every day? When was the last time you paused and thought, “This tastes like home”?
For most of us living in Delhi NCR, students, working professionals, and hustlers, ghar ka khana isn’t just a phrase. It’s a feeling. A soft round chapati, tadka dal, sabzi with just the right amount of spices, a bowl of raita and papad - it is something people away from home miss badly.
In a world of 10-minute deliveries and 2-minute noodles, there’s still nothing quite like that first bite of food made by someone who cooks (maybe not exactly) but similar to how your mom cooks.
Why Ghar Ka Khana Still Hits Different
There’s a reason we crave it. And it has nothing to do with presentation. Ghar ka khana is slow, full of warmth, and comforting. It’s food that reminds you: 'You are not alone'.
Beyond the emotional chord, there’s a physical one. You know the ingredients. The oil isn’t recycled. The spice levels are just right - not less, not more. And there’s no mystery colour to give the gravy an extra red appearance.
